Taking over from tonight. Current state: the Scrubjay EXIF-stripping service is stable; one flapping alert on the thumbnail lane, muted until morning. Plugin authors: note that hooks registering custom metadata fields must now declare them in the manifest or Scrubjay drops them silently — this changed in release nine. Two third-party plugins are still failing validation; owners were notified. Don't redeploy the sanitizer without re-running the conformance suite. Plugin-side questions or manifest exemptions go to the address below.

billing contact of yawip-yadup = druath.casdor@nelvrolabs.internal

Subject: On-call heads-up — Orchardly catalog cache. Welcome aboard. The main gotcha: catalog price updates invalidate by SKU, but bundle pages cache composite keys, so a stale bundle can outlive its parts. If support reports wrong bundle prices, purge the composite namespace first. We'll cover this at the weekly sync; the invalidation playbook is on this internal page.

wiki page, yagef-tawif: https://sentry.lumicdata.local/view/merge_requests/pipeline/merge_requests/e08f7f35c80b5755

## Account Recovery — Trailnote Offline Mode

When a surveyor's Trailnote app has been offline for 30+ days, their local credentials expire and sync refuses to resume. Don't make them wipe the device — all their unsynced field data lives there! Instead, open the support console, pick "Offline Reinstate," and enter their handle. The console will ask for the support team's shared recovery passphrase before issuing a reinstatement token. Use the one below.

unlock words, bagaf-fajeg: zorael-kelax-fraath-quenix-eliok-sileth-aldmir-wenir-druiel